Set in the Witcher world, Sirius Project was originally supposed to be different from CD Projekt Red’s other titles by offering multiplayer gameplay and a single-player campaign experience. The Molasses Flood is a small studio with experience in producing multiplayer titles. Drake Hollow was to embark on this ambitious project . Sirius Project is still in development, but as far as we know, CD Projekt Red may take the project in a new direction in the coming months.

Sirius Project is one of five titles currently in development by CD Projekt Red or acquired studios.In addition to Sirius and polaris plan the long-awaited sequel witcher 3 ,project Orion , Canis Major and Hadar All in development.
